A Small Redirect Sparks Big PI-Binance Speculation
A tweet from The Times of PiNetwork highlighted something interesting. If you type in pi.binance.com, it takes you straight to Binance’s official homepage. But if you try pi.coinbase.com, it doesn’t lead anywhere. On the surface, that might not seem like much. But in the crypto space, small details like this often spark big theories.
Some in the community believe that this redirect means Binance could be preparing a dedicated page for Pi coin. This sort of redirect sometimes happens when an exchange wants to secure a domain early, possibly for a listing in the future. Exchanges like Binance often do this to protect their branding or avoid phishing attempts.
However, if you try pi.coinbase.com, it doesn't lead anywhere. At least not yet.
This difference clearly indicates that Binance is "one step ahead" in this "race."

Coinbase not doing the same adds more fuel to the idea that Binance might be a step ahead when it comes to listing Pi coin. There’s no way to know for sure, but this small move has definitely reignited discussion in the community.
There are a few more reasons why people believe Binance could still list PI. First, Pi recently received massive support during Binance’s community voting process. The project got nearly 295,000 votes, and more than 86 percent of them were in favor of a listing. That kind of backing is hard to ignore.
Second, the Pi Network team has launched its Open Mainnet. That’s a big milestone. Usually, top exchanges like Binance wait for a mainnet launch before even considering listing a token. Without that, the token lacks the stability and structure they need. The Pi Core Team has also been working on compliance, which is essential for passing Binance’s internal checks.
Even with all these signs, Binance has not made anything official yet. So while the redirect, community votes, and technical progress are encouraging, they don’t mean a listing is guaranteed. Exchanges take a lot of factors into account before making a final decision. Sometimes they secure a domain name and never use it. That’s why some experts urge caution.
Mainnet Wallet Rollout Brings More People Into the Pi Ecosystem
In another major update, Pi Network announced a feature that makes it possible for more users to join the action on the Mainnet. The Pi Core Team revealed that newly released tools allow identity-verified users to activate their Mainnet wallets. This means that out of the millions of people who have passed, or nearly passed, KYC, more can now get direct access to the ecosystem.
This is a big deal for adoption. Now, users can start interacting with Pi apps, trade or shop in local Pi-based commerce, and even take part in special events like the .pi Domains Auction. This kind of activity builds real-world utility for Pi, which is exactly the kind of thing exchanges want to see before listing a coin.
With more users onboard and new features going live, Pi is showing steady progress toward becoming a fully functioning crypto project. If it keeps moving in this direction, it may only be a matter of time before major exchanges take notice.
